WesTrac is seeking an experienced Warehouse Operator to join our team at Cadia, NSW, on a Monday to Friday day shift. You will pick, pack and dispatch parts, manage stock and conduct regular inventory checks, and operate forklift equipment to support safe material handling.
Ideally, you hold an HRW forklift licence and have prior warehouse experience. This role offers strong job security, progression opportunities, and relocation support for eligible candidates.
